r虽然网上有很多关于虚拟环境的配置和requirements.txt的文章,但是个人觉有的过于繁琐有的可能又无法实现,特别是一些问题的出现比较的小众,短时间内没有办法得到解决(如版本不对、库与库之间的冲突等导致无法直接进行)。因此本文想用简易的方式和较为通解的方式来阐述安装的步骤,并且对一些可能出现的问题进行分析和提前规避。本安装步骤较为基础,并且是主要针对于版本不对、库与库之间的冲突等导致无法直接进行requirements.txt安装的情况。1.为啥要配置虚拟环境虚拟环境究竟有什么用,对于初学者而言肯定听说很多人说关于虚拟环境的优点。虚拟环境确实有很多的长处,我们可以把虚拟环境理解为一个“
r虽然网上有很多关于虚拟环境的配置和requirements.txt的文章,但是个人觉有的过于繁琐有的可能又无法实现,特别是一些问题的出现比较的小众,短时间内没有办法得到解决(如版本不对、库与库之间的冲突等导致无法直接进行)。因此本文想用简易的方式和较为通解的方式来阐述安装的步骤,并且对一些可能出现的问题进行分析和提前规避。本安装步骤较为基础,并且是主要针对于版本不对、库与库之间的冲突等导致无法直接进行requirements.txt安装的情况。1.为啥要配置虚拟环境虚拟环境究竟有什么用,对于初学者而言肯定听说很多人说关于虚拟环境的优点。虚拟环境确实有很多的长处,我们可以把虚拟环境理解为一个“
常见的方法:1、pipfreezen>requirements.txt导出结果中可能存在路径2piplist--format=freeze>requirement.txt导出不带路径的注意:生成requirements.txt,pipfreeze会将当前PC环境下所有的安装包都进行生成,再进行安装的时候会全部安装很多没有的包.此方法要注意。3、conda中导出requirements.txt方式一、a.导出condalist-e>requirements.txtb.导入安装condainstall--yes--filerequirements.txt方式二、c.导出yml文件方式condaen
常见的方法:1、pipfreezen>requirements.txt导出结果中可能存在路径2piplist--format=freeze>requirement.txt导出不带路径的注意:生成requirements.txt,pipfreeze会将当前PC环境下所有的安装包都进行生成,再进行安装的时候会全部安装很多没有的包.此方法要注意。3、conda中导出requirements.txt方式一、a.导出condalist-e>requirements.txtb.导入安装condainstall--yes--filerequirements.txt方式二、c.导出yml文件方式condaen
在Python项目中,我们通常使用requirement.txt文件记录项目所依赖的第三方库,以便在其他机器上部署项目时更方便地安装这些依赖。在使用requirement.txt安装依赖时,可以按照以下步骤进行:安装pip要使用requirement.txt安装依赖,首先需要在你的机器上安装pip。pip是Python官方推荐的第三方库管理工具,用于在Python环境中安装、升级、卸载第三方库。在终端中输入以下命令,即可安装pip:curlhttps://bootstrap.pypa.io/get-pip.py-oget-pip.pypythonget-pip.py进入项目目录在进行依赖安装前
批处理批量全篇替换txt文本文件中指定字符信息,修改三个参数后即可使用,话不多说直接上代码:@echooffsetlocalEnableDelayedExpansionsetpath_str="C:\Users\Administrator\Desktop\1.txt"setold_str=需要替换的原文本内容setnew_str=替换后的文本内容setsouerce_path=%path_str%for/f"tokens=1*delims=:"%%iin('findstr/n.*"%souerce_path%"')do( set"lineContent=%%j" setlocalEnabl
vim对js文件和txt的操作不同https://www.runoob.com/w3cnote/ascii.html同样一段话,vim123.txt和vim123.js,将下面这些内容复制,然后粘贴,显示的效果不一样.js文件会把0D0A变换为0A09import{request}from"@/api/service";import{BUTTON_STATUS_NUMBER}from"@/config/button";import{urlPrefixasbookPrefix}from"./api";exportconstcrudOptions=vm=>{return{pageOptions:{
引言近期使用了airmon-ng进行wifi密码破解,虽然抓到了包,但是由于kali自带wifite.txt太弱,未能匹配出密码,因此我使用了rockyou.txt。起初rockyou.txt是未解压的状态,名称为rockyou.txt.gz,位于/usr/share/wordlists文件夹中。此处只说明其解压方法,有效性另说。一般来说破译需要针对性的字典,而不是数据量庞大的字典,毕竟计算机计算能力是有限的。另外,如果想建立自己专属的密码字典,可以尝试使用crunch工具。方法第一步首先我们要知道rockyou.txt文件压缩包的位置,其实在引言中已经提到了/usr/share/wordli
第一步:在主目录下找到模板文件夹;第二步::在模板文件夹下右键(选择在终端中打开)第三步:在终端中输入:sudogedit新建文本文档.txt,然后输入密码即可;第四步:在新建文本文档.txt右上角点击保存即可;第五步:即可在任意位置新建文本文档.txt
我有有效的requirements.txt文件,但docker没有安装requirements中列出的包之一Docker版本18.09.2python3.7.3需求.txtdjango==2.2.2celery==4.2.1selenium==3.141.0BeautifulSoup4==4.7.1redis==3.2.0docker文件FROMpython:3.7ENVPYTHONUNBUFFERED1ENVDJANGO_ENVdevENVDJANGO_ENVdevCOPY./requirements.txt/code/requirements.txtRUNpip3install--